ABS Control Module Failure? Diagnose & Repair

Experiencing some problem with the ABS ? This faulty ABS control computer can result in warning lights on the dashboard and affect vehicle 's brake performance . Diagnosing the control unit involves reviewing error messages using an scan tool and thoroughly testing electrical connectors . Fixes range from repairing internal components to substituting a new ABS control module , which can be difficult and often requires professional assistance .

ABS Unit vs. ABS Control Module : A Difference

Many vehicle owners are unclear on the purposes of the ABS pump and the ABS computer in their auto's braking Used abs control module Nebraska setup . It’s crucial to recognize that they are distinct elements working in conjunction but with unique responsibilities . The ABS assembly is the physical gadget that pushes brake hydraulic fluid to the rotors, rapidly applying and disengaging brake force during an emergency stop. In contrast , the ABS controller is the computerized "brain" that observes wheel rate indicators and directs the ABS unit to modulate brake tension. Think of the pump as the mechanism and the control module as the conductor – both are essential for the correct performance of the braking system.

  • This ABS unit provides hydraulic force .
  • This ABS computer oversees the operation.
  • Both work together for best braking.
